What is the Asthma Action Plan for Child?

The Asthma Action Plan for Child is a critical healthcare tool used to manage and monitor a child's asthma effectively. This structured form includes key components such as sections for recording asthma triggers, symptoms, medication details, and emergency procedures. A vital aspect of the document is the requirement for signatures from both the parent or guardian and the child’s doctor, ensuring that both parties are aligned in the child's asthma management strategy.

Key Features of the Asthma Action Plan for Child

The asthma action plan includes several key features that enhance its usability and effectiveness. Important elements consist of:
  • Fillable fields for easy input of details
  • Severity zones marked as Green, Yellow, and Red for quick reference
  • Sections detailing medication schedules and dosages
  • Identification of asthma triggers and related symptoms
These features support both parents or guardians and healthcare providers in managing the child's asthma effectively.
